“Very entertaining! Just a blast!”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ed November 5, 2012

We really enjoyed our layover in Nairobi at Giraffe Manor. While we only spent one very jet-lagged evening and night there, we loved every minute. We sat outside in the early evening watching and feeding the giraffes, and had a lovely dinner afterwards. Our room on the first floor was very spacious and comfortable and we had a great night's sleep there. A lovely breakfast in the morning and then we were gone. We spoke with other guests who were staying longer and it sounded like there were some excellent local activities, but a change in our flight limited us to just one night. Highly recommended!

“I have mixed feelings about Giraffe Manor”
3 of 5 stars Reviewed October 14, 2012

We stayed at Giraffe Manor for two nights in October 2012. The things that I loved were the great staff, great food and of course the giraffes and warthogs. And lunch outside in the beautiful gardens. However, our very small room was directly over the kitchen and so was quite loud (although it smelled good!). The original house has been joined by a new building in the back. For $1,000 a night I felt that we should be able to have breakfast with the giraffes in the main house (where our room was). Unfortunately we were shunted off to the new addition. Us and the warthogs.... I guess the trick is to show up early for breakfast to make sure you are seated in the right place. Don't think I'll be going back.

“Magical”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ed September 30, 2012

Everything about Giraffe Manor is top-notch, which we discovered the moment we arrived: it was 10:15 at night, at the end of an 8-hour flight from London, which came after a 6-hour flight from the United States. They provided us dinner! First in importance here is feeding the giraffes their kibble from the breakfast room each morning, undoubtedly a unique experience and perfectly charming. The wonderful staff even carefully framed the pictures they took of us doing this. Our room was huge and comfortable, and the bathroom equally so. We never sat down anywhere for more than a few moments before a staff member would inquire if he or she could get something for us. Food was plentiful and delicious, and we met interesting people around the large dinner table and during drinks. And everything was covered in the initial cost of the room, including a driver to take us around. That was perhaps what we most appreciated. The only glitch was that the Internet was not working well, and even when it was fixed, it wasn't very good. That aside, I would say that this is one of the most memorable places we have ever stayed at. Anyone who is planning to be near Nairobi should consider it (it's not cheap).
